Bridge Snapshot: NO DATA ENTERED
The NO DATA ENTERED bridge in Kittitas, Washington carries NO DATA ENTERED over CABIN CREEK. It was built in 1989, making it 37 years old today. The structure is built primarily of steel and spans 1 section, stretching 6.2 meters (20 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 5 vehicles, placing it in the lower-traffic tier of Washington bridges. It is owned and maintained by U.S. Forest Service.
The latest FHWA inspection records show culvert at 6/9. The weakest component sits in fair condition. All reported major components score above the Poor range.
